Galatasaray Star Victor Osimhen Undergoes Successful Surgery After Champions League Injury
Turkish champions Galatasaray have confirmed that Nigerian striker Victor Osimhen has successfully undergone surgery following a significant hand injury sustained during a recent European clash.
The incident occurred during the first half of the UEFA Champions League Round of 16 second-leg match against Liverpool at Anfield, where Osimhen suffered a fractured right forearm following a mid-air collision with defender Ibrahima Konaté.
Although the 27-year-old forward attempted to play through the pain with a heavily bandaged arm, he was ultimately substituted at halftime as the severity of the injury became apparent.
In an official statement released on Monday, March 23, 2026, the club announced that the procedure was performed by head doctor Yener İnce at Maslak Acıbadem Hospital.
While the surgery was a success, the loss of their star forward is a major blow to the Istanbul giants, especially following their 4-1 aggregate elimination from the Champions League. Osimhen, who has been in sensational form this season with 19 goals across all competitions, reportedly received messages of support from Liverpool players following the accidental clash.
Galatasaray has not yet provided a definitive timeline for the striker’s return to the pitch, stating that his recovery will be monitored on a daily basis.
However, early medical assessments suggest a total absence of approximately four to six weeks. The club expressed their best wishes for a rapid recovery, hoping to have their leading goalscorer back in time for the critical final stretch of the domestic league season, including the highly anticipated Intercontinental Derby against rivals Fenerbahçe in late April.
